Magnesium Sulphate and Rocuronium in Patients Over 60

The purpose of this study is to evaluate the effects of MgSO4 administration on the pharmacodynamics of rocuronium in patients with 60 or more years of age.

Inclusion criteria

  • 60 years or older
  • ASA physical status I-III
  • Scheduled for elective oncologic head and neck surgery

Exclusion criteria

  • Severe renal insufficiency (calculated creatinine clearance < 30 ml/min)
  • Pre-operatory serum magnesium values > 2.5 mEq/l
  • Patients receiving medications known to affect neuromuscular function (furosemide, aminoglycoside, anticonvulsivants, calcio channel blocker, litium, azatioprine, cyclofosfamide)

Treatment and study plan

Magnesium sulfate

Drug

MgSO4 30 mg/kg in 0.9% physiological saline (total volume 100 ml) intravenously, for 10 min, and then continuous intravenous infusion of MgSO4 at a rate of 1 g/h during the surgical procedure until the maximum of 3 h

Placebo

Drug

100 ml of 0.9% physiological saline, for 10 min, and then continuous intravenous infusion of saline at a rate of 33 ml/h during the surgical procedure until the maximum of 3 h

Primary outcomes

  1. Total recovery time of neuromuscular block (DurTOF0.9)

    Time frame: Within the surgical procedure

    Time from the start of injection of rocuronium until TOF ratio 0.9

Secondary outcomes

  1. Onset time

    Time frame: Within the surgical procedure

    Time from the start of injection of rocuronium until 95% depression of the first twitch (T1) of the TOF

  2. Clinical duration (Dur25%)

    Time frame: Within the surgical procedure

    Time from the start of injection of rocuronium until T1 of the TOF had recovered to 25% of the initial T1 value

  3. Recovery index (Dur25-75%)

    Time frame: Within the surgical procedure

    Time between 25% and 75% recovery of the initial T1 value

  4. Recovery time (Dur25%TOF0.9)

    Time frame: Within the surgical procedure

    Time between 25% recovery of the initial T1 value and a TOF ratio of 0.9
